In residential applications, stirring power tools are commonly used for home improvement projects, DIY tasks, and small-scale construction activities. These tools are ideal for mixing paints, adhesives, mortar, and other materials required in home renovation and repair work. Their lightweight and portable designs make them an excellent choice for homeowners looking to complete projects efficiently without hiring professional services. Residential users often seek power tools that offer ease of use, durability, and versatility. Stirring power tools that cater to this segment typically come with adjustable speed settings, multiple attachments, and user-friendly designs, allowing homeowners to complete a variety of tasks with minimal effort.

In the construction industry, stirring power tools play a vital role in ensuring the efficiency of operations. These tools are typically used for mixing large quantities of cement, grout, adhesives, and other construction materials. The high power and durability of these tools are crucial for demanding construction projects where large volumes of material need to be mixed quickly and evenly. Stirring power tools designed for the construction field often come with heavy-duty motors and robust construction, allowing them to handle demanding tasks in challenging environments. The industrial field is another significant segment driving the stirring power tools market. These tools are extensively used in manufacturing plants, factories, and other industrial settings for mixing raw materials, chemicals, and other substances required for production processes. Stirring power tools designed for industrial use are built to withstand high-frequency usage and offer enhanced performance to meet the rigorous demands of industrial operations. The industrial segment typically requires power tools with specialized features, such as higher torque capabilities, larger mixing volumes, and rugged designs to ensure consistent and efficient operation in tough environments.

The "Others" segment of the stirring power tools market includes a variety of niche applications, such as laboratories, research settings, and specialized workshops. In these environments, stirring power tools are used for mixing and homogenizing small batches of materials or substances. Tools in this category are often designed for precision and control, ensuring that the correct proportions and mixing speeds are achieved. While these applications are not as widespread as residential, construction, or industrial uses, they are important in supporting various scientific, technical, and artistic fields where accurate mixing is critical.

The stirring power tools market is currently witnessing several key trends that are shaping its growth. One of the most prominent trends is the increasing adoption of cordless stirring power tools. The demand for cordless models is fueled by the growing need for mobility and ease of use across different sectors. These tools offer greater convenience and flexibility, particularly in environments where power outlets are not readily available. Additionally, advancements in battery technology have improved the performance and run-time of cordless stirring tools, making them more viable for demanding applications.
